Turkey-Squash Casserole

Yield: 6 servings
Source: "Magic Menus for People with Diabetes"

2 tablespoons margarine
1 medium onion, chopped
1-1/2 pound yellow squash, sliced
1 cup shredded carrots
3 cups Pepperidge Farm stuffing mix
1 cup fat-free sour cream
1 egg
1 cup fat-free reduced-sodium chicken broth
or enough to moisten
12 ounces skinless turkey breast, cubed

Preheat oven to 375 degrees F. Saute onion in margarine. Mix with
remaining ingredients. Pour into 2-quart baking dish coated with nonstick
cooking spray. Bake 30-40 minutes or until bubbly.

Nutritional Information Per Serving (1/6 of recipe): Calories: 298, Fat: 5
g, Cholesterol: 73 mg, Carbohydrate: 37 g, Dietary Fiber: 5 g, Sugars: 9
g, Protein: 22 g Diabetic Exchanges: 2 Starch, 2 Very Lean Meat, 1
Vegetable, 1 Fat
